Lindsay Lohan is an American actress, singer, and songwriter who gained fame at a young age and has since become a controversial figure in the entertainment industry. Born on July 2, 1986, in New York City, Lohan began her career as a child model before transitioning into acting.
Lohan's breakthrough role came in 1998 when she starred in the Disney film "The Parent Trap," where she played dual roles as twin sisters. This performance showcased her talent and charm, leading to more opportunities in the industry. She went on to star in several successful films, including "Freaky Friday" (2003), "Mean Girls" (2004), and "Herbie: Fully Loaded" (2005). Lohan's performances were often praised for her ability to bring depth and vulnerability to her characters.
However, as Lohan's career was reaching new heights, her personal life began to spiral out of control. She became a frequent tabloid target due to her partying lifestyle, legal troubles, and struggles with substance abuse. Lohan's behavior led to multiple arrests and stints in rehab, which ultimately affected her professional reputation.
Despite her personal struggles, Lohan continued to work in the entertainment industry. She released her debut music album, "Speak," in 2004, which received mixed reviews but performed well commercially. Lohan also ventured into fashion, launching her own clothing line, and made appearances in reality TV shows like "Lindsay Lohan's Beach Club" (2019).
